The FreeWidgetFoundation FileSelector widget, which I used, is Xt-based and works well. It has a device-independent directory manager section that I was able to configure for my Amiga with little problem. It comes with the standard Unix directory scanning routines. 2. David Nedde has taken the file requestor code out of xdbx, and made it more generally applicable. He can be reached at: daven@[maxine|wpi].wpi.edu for more details on this. -Randy O'Reilly
